Foxit Reader: Foxit Reader is a free PDF reader that provides fast PDF viewing, editing, organizing and security features. It is a lightweight alternative to Adobe Acrobat Reader.

R (programming language): R is a free, open-source programming language and software environment for statistical analysis, data visualization, and scientific computing. It is widely used by statisticians, data miners, data analysts, and data scientists for developing statistical software and data analysis.

R (programming language)
R (programming language)
Pros
  • Open source
  • Large community support
  • Extensive package ecosystem
  • Runs on multiple platforms
  • Integrates with other languages
  • Flexible and extensible
Cons
  • Steep learning curve
  • Less user-friendly than proprietary statistical software
  • Can be slow for large datasets
  • Limited graphical user interface
  • Version inconsistencies
  • Poor memory management
